Output d18989e6e330c4c953d310e209275bda4990cb9543f3fd27d328111ad9385f61:19

value
9473884
script pubkey
OP_0 OP_PUSHBYTES_20 8e13c2e42e4ef166b8c672a5c2322d3d0b780450
address
bc1q3cfu9epwfmckdwxxw2juyv3d859hspzsavly8d
transaction
d18989e6e330c4c953d310e209275bda4990cb9543f3fd27d328111ad9385f61